Record 2, Textual support, English
Record number: 2, Textual support number: 1 DEF
In the context of independent parallel approaches, a corridor of airspace of defined dimensions located centrally between the two extended runway centre lines, where a penetration by an aircraft requires a controller intervention to manoeuvre any threatened aircraft on the adjacent approach. [Definition officially approved by ICAO. ] 1, record 2, English, - no%20transgression%20zone

Record 4, Textual support, English
Record number: 4, Textual support number: 1 OBS
With the establishment of the new Science, Technology and Innovation Council(STIC), the roles and responsibilities of a number of federal advisory bodies, including the Office of the National Science Advisor(ONSA), were reviewed. In this context, the Office will be phased out, the position of National Science Advisor will be discontinued, and the STIC will function as a single external committee, providing the government with independent and integrated advice on science and technology. The Science and Innovation Sector of Industry Canada and the Department of Foreign Affairs and International Trade will assume programmatic activities of the ONSA. 1, record 4, English, - National%20Science%20Advisor%20to%20the%20Government%20of%20Canada

Record 6, Textual support, English
Record number: 6, Textual support number: 1 DEF
Techniques used for the reduction of space, bandwidth, cost transmission, generating time, and the storage of data. 3, record 6, English, - data%20compression
Record number: 6, Textual support number: 1 CONT
Data compression techniques can be divided into the irreversible and reversible categories. The irreversible techniques are usually called data compaction. The compression may be followed by expansion which recovers the original data. The semantic independent compression techniques do not use any information regarding the content of data. The semantic dependent techniques depend on(and are optimized for) the context and semantics of data to provide for redundancy reduction. 4, record 6, English, - data%20compression
Record number: 6, Textual support number: 1 OBS
These techniques are designed for the elimination of repetition, removal of irrelevancies, and they employ special coding techniques. 3, record 6, English, - data%20compression
